On 2002-10-31 09:52, Todd Hansen <tshansen@nlanr.net> wrote:
> http://www.freebsd.org/send-pr.html
>
> returns: Forbidden
>
> That link is on the front of the www.freebsd.org website.

There was a recent flood of bogus PRs sent from the web interface,
that caused problems to the Ports Team.  This has been disabled
(hopefully for a short while), until we find a better way to get PRs
through the web.  I'm sorry for any inconvenience this has caused.

Thanks for reporting what you thought was a problem with the site.
